Dan Tana's -
9071 Santa Monica Blvd , West Hollywood , CA 90069
A great
late night hang out for hungry celebrities, Dan Tana's offers
up privacy as well as outstanding food. Whether it's a steak,
lasagna or chicken that you're after, you can find it all
and a whole lot more at Dan Tana's.
The Kettle - 1138 Highland Ave , Manhattan
Beach , CA 90266
If you're looking for something a bit different
after hours, check out The Kettle. Good, homemade food waits
to take that late night craving away. Try a homemade bran
muffin, the Chinese chicken salad or a guavamosa (guava juice
and champagne
Pacific Dining Car - 2700 Wilshire Blvd.,
Santa Monica, CA 90403
A great late night steak or a great
late night breakfast are on the menu at this old fashioned
yet elegant establishment. Modeled after the original Pacific
Dining Car, this more modern facility also offers up lobster,
grilled chicken as well as many other choices. |

Houston 's - 10250 Santa Monica
Blvd. Los Angeles, CA
An upbeat casual
atmosphere, Houston 's is a great place to relax after a
long day of shopping. While you're there make sure and try
The Spinach Dip and the Shrimp Pizza, two dishes that will
make you want to go back for more.
Sterling Steak House - 1429 Ivar Ave , Hollywood
, CA 90028
If you're ready to throw down some money and splurge
on a meal, Sterling 's is definitely the place to do it. Sterling
's offers dry-aged prime steaks and seafood, along with 25
delectable side dishes, and a very well stocked bar. Arrive
hungry, leave completely satisfied with food, service and ambiance.
Mr. Chow - 344 N Camden Dr , Beverly Hills
, CA 90210
A popular spot among the stars, Mr. Chow's
serves up some healthful Chinese cuisine. White glove treatment
is given to every visitor to this restaurant and first timers
should definitely depend on the recommendations from the
wait staff. |

Moose McGillycuddy's -
119 E Colorado Blvd , Pasadena , CA 91105
Offering up a bit
of down home family type of atmosphere, Moose McGillycuddy's
is a great place to catch some sports while indulging on
their famous fajita, wings and nachos. Weeknight themes abound
with disco night and karaoke night. Stop on by for some fun.
Champs
Sports Pub - 4103 W Burbank Blvd , Burbank , CA
91505
If there was ever a place that could be called “your
typical sports bar” this would be it. Nothing fancy, nothing
over done just good food, friends and fun. During the off
season, drop in to watch or participate in the weekly trivia
challenge.
Barney's Beanery - 8447
Santa Monica Blvd, West Hollywood, CA 90069
Just imagine
being able to choose between 150 types of hamburgers, 200
kinds of beer, 90 omelets, 50 sandwiches, 20 hotdogs and
65 variations of chili. Add to those pool tables, video games
and television screens, why would you go anywhere else? |

Vine - 1235 N. Vine St. , Hollywood ,
CA 90028
There is definitely something for everyone in the
Los Angels area and if you're looking for something a bit
more retro, look no further than Vine. The DJ will provide
you with rock, surf, and punk sounds while you cozy up to
the fondue bar or sit back and relax with some wine and cheese.
LAX – 1714 N. Las Palmas Ave , Hollywood
, CA
This airport themed club is all the
rage in LA. With a bar resembling a runway, a hanger door
leading to one of the two patios as well as airport themed
drinks, this is one of the newest places in which to hang
out and be seen.
The
Conga Room - 5364 Wilshire Blvd , Los Angeles
, CA 90036
The Salsa is extra spicy at The Conga Room.
Latin pop, rock and traditional beats great dancers as
they make their way between the main bar and the dance
floor into an elaborately decorated club. Weekly dance
themes often draw a celebrity following. |

The Four Seasons Hotel Spa - 300 South
Doheny Drive , Los Angeles , California
The Four Seasons
offers a full menu of California inspired treatments including
all of the traditional massages as well as it's own Punta
Mita Massage, and the Raindrop Aromatherapy Massage. Skincare
treatments are also available including the Gentlemen's Facial
and the Sea of Life Facial .
Paint Shop Beverly Hills - 319 1/2 S.
Robertson Blvd , Beverly Hills , CA
A hip hop beat will greet
you but soon you will relax in large throne-like chairs
while you indulge in manicures and pedicures which have
been elevated to a new level of profound enjoyment. Indulge
in a apple scented “Shaken not Stirred” manicure
or a “Footsie White Choco-Latte” pedicure. Ohhh, the
temptations are endless.
Garden Sanctuary - 426 S. Robertson Blvd.
, Los Angeles , CA
This unique day spa offers a complete array of services. Spend a rejuvenating
day here and enjoy a complete make. The Garden Sanctuary offers several packages
and many a la carte services including make-up applications, hair color and
style, massage, manicures, pedicures and waxing. It's a one stop shop for relaxation
and beauty. |

Shopping – Rodeo Drive
Full of fabulous Italian boutiques, exquisite jewelers, and French fashion
houses. Shopping is at its finest along one of the most famous streets
in the world.
Theme/Adventure Parks
The greater Los Angeles area offers a wide variety of family fun. Knott's Berry
Farm, Magic Mountain , Disneyland and Universal Studios are some of the most
popular attractions. Pick your travel time wisely as lines for rides and
food can become quiet long.
Sporting Events
Previously home to the Summer Olympics, Los Angeles
is rich in sporting venues. The NBA, NFL, NHL and NASCAR
are favorites among avid sports fans. |
